Mikel Navarro

Mikel Navarro holds a PhD from the University of Deusto (1988) where he became professor of Economics in 1994. His career has been linked to this university where he has carried out different functions in management, teaching and research. In the management area, he was Vice Dean responsible for Research as well as Head of the Economics Department at the School of Economics and Business Administration (ESTE). He was also a member of the Doctoral Board of the University of Deusto for many years. He was responsible for the Microeconomics of Competitiveness course (MOC) both when it was run by the University of Deusto and when it moved to the Basque Institute of Competitiveness.


In the teaching area, he has been a faculty member in the undergraduate and graduate courses of the ESTE since 1986, in the field of the economic environment of companies as well as that of economic and industrial policies. He has lectured in the MOC course since its creation and more recently, when the Deusto Business School was created, he participated in their executive courses. In the research area he has specialized in competitiveness and innovation, fields in which he has directed more than twenty research projects with external funds. He has also published a dozen books and about fifty scientific articles or chapters of books in national and international publications, and participated in countless international conferences and workshops. He is currently a member of the editorial board of the economic journal Ekonomiaz. As an expert, he has participated in the discussion of many of the industrial and innovation policies set up in the Basque Country.


He participated actively in the creation of the Basque Institute of Competiveness, of which he was the first academic director. Currently, he is senior researcher in the Institute’s Area of Clusters, Regional Development and Innovation.
